Hungarian Mushroom Soup

This hearty Hungarian mushroom soup is seasoned generously with paprika, fresh parsley, and lemon juice. Sour cream makes it rich and creamy.

Chef's notes

Use Hungarian sweet paprika if you can find it — it has a deeper, more floral flavor than generic paprika and is central to the soup's character; smoked paprika can substitute but will shift the flavor profile noticeably. Whisk the flour into the milk thoroughly before adding it to the pot; any lumps in the slurry will persist in the finished soup, so take 30 seconds to get it smooth. The biggest mistake is boiling the soup after the sour cream goes in — keep heat on low and stir gently to avoid curdling; the target temperature is around 160 degrees F, well below a simmer. Prep the onions, mushrooms, and parsley before you start cooking; the stove steps move quickly and the soup benefits from not rushing the mushroom sauté, which concentrates flavor. The soup keeps refrigerated for up to 3 days; reheat gently over low heat, stirring frequently, as the sour cream can break if rushed over high heat.
